What's the company culture like at Sensata Xirgo?

Strengths in collegial support, empowerment, and learning coexist with reports of micromanagement, communication gaps, and change-related strain. Together, these dynamics suggest a culture that can be rewarding and growth-oriented but varies by site and leader, leading to uneven day-to-day experiences.

Key Insight for Candidates

Defining tradeoff: Sensata’s quality-first, process-heavy “OneSensata” culture delivers stability and ERG-backed belonging, but often feels bureaucratic—while the spun-out Xirgo runs faster with less structure and more management churn. This matters because your daily autonomy, pace, recognition, and stress level hinge on which side of the split you join.

Positive Themes About Sensata Xirgo

  • Collaborative & Supportive Culture: Feedback suggests teams are collaborative and colleagues are helpful, with a sense of community reinforced by employee-led resource groups and belonging initiatives. Feedback suggests interns and many employees experience clear expectations alongside autonomy in a supportive environment.
  • Empowering & Trusting Leadership: Feedback suggests leaders often encourage new ideas and give employees ownership of their work. Feedback suggests individuals are trusted to introduce creative ideas and drive projects independently.
  • Learning & Knowledge Sharing: Feedback suggests there are strong opportunities to learn and advance across technical and managerial paths. Feedback suggests fast-paced projects provide substantial exposure that builds skills and experience.

Considerations About Sensata Xirgo

  • High-Pressure & Micromanaging Culture: Feedback suggests an authoritarian atmosphere and micromanagement appear in some areas, limiting collaboration and innovation. Feedback suggests resource constraints and pressure can diminish motivation and create a disheartening experience.
  • Poor Communication: Feedback suggests unclear communication, limited constructive feedback, and strained manager interactions make progress hard to gauge. Feedback suggests global dispersion and site-to-site variability complicate coordination and teamwork.
  • Change Fatigue & Ineffective Decision-Making: Feedback suggests instability, leadership gaps, and reorganizations contribute to ambiguity and stress. Feedback suggests cost-minimizing choices and shifting structures can signal efficiency priorities over employee support.
